UK Gambling Commission
National regulator for commercial gambling in Great Britain and the UK National Lottery

The Gambling Commission licenses and regulates commercial gambling offered to consumers in Great Britain and regulates the National Lottery across the United Kingdom. Its remit covers remote gambling, casinos, betting, bingo, software, machines, and named lottery activities, but excludes customer redress, premises licensing, spread betting, and several locally regulated activities.
